## Pagination Env Vars — PerchAPI

Quick notes before cutting a release: PAGE_SIZE_DEFAULT is 25 and PAGE_SIZE_MAX is 200 — don't bump the max without checking the Lorinth cache tier first. CURSOR_TTL_MINUTES controls how long page cursors stay valid; 60 is fine. Cursors are signed so clients can't forge offsets, and the signing secret goes on the next line:

secret setting of fawep-tagaf: ARCHIVE_KEY3=ce5

# Break-Glass: Furrowbeam Telemetry Gateway

For the weekly eng sync: break-glass applies only when the Furrowbeam gateway stops relaying tractor and combine telemetry entirely. Steps: page the duty lead, flip the gateway to safe-relay mode, log the incident. Entry to safe-relay mode requires the recovery passphrase shown below.

unlock words, hahip-baduf: holwyn-istath-julvan

Service accounts for Paylark integration tests. Tests against the settlement sandbox flake when the shared account hits rate limits, so each engineer gets a dedicated test account. Request one in the team channel; provisioning takes a day. Never reuse accounts across CI and local runs. The CI pipeline authenticates to the sandbox gateway with the key below.

gateway credential: kto23_LX9A4ys6i4nzHtpOLNLodKK